Reduce power consumption

Hello Dear; 

I'm developing a low power phy beacon device. But my device current consumption is about 0,7mA. After sending an advertisement, the current consumption should decrease, but in my device remains constant. I wonder if the battery level running in the background is affecting the reading? Is it good for phy coded device? How do I reduce to power consumption?

Note: I can't use deep sleep because I want my device to wake up automatically.

  • Hi,

    There are a couple of steps that you can implement to do decrease the power consumption:

    1. You can turn off the logger module. Disable logging in the sdk_config.h file
    2. Use RTC + PPI to enable the EasyDMA only during sampling. See this example.
